Geocache Description:

Ed's Circuit is a series of 16 caches that we have placed on a circular route that Miss Chilihouse went round many times in the Spring of 2008 when she enjoyed a loan of a piebald pony called Ed based in the stables near to the second cache in this series.

You will see many horses (and probably other wildlife) on this circuit, possibly being ridden but definitely in the fields that you pass.

The circuit is a mixture of bridleways, footpaths and lanes, with a very short connecting stretch on a busier road. It is likely to be very muddy in places so appropriate footwear will be needed. The difficulty & terrain ratings reflect the series and not this individual cache.

Suggested parking is on Compton Street, the entrance of which can be found at N51°01.704 W001°19.910.

Many of the caches contain a pen or pencil whilst some don't - if you are planning on doing the series then please remember to bring something to write with.

You are looking for a 35mm film container. Please re-hide carefully.
